Reclaimed wood headboards are a popular choice among homeowners looking to add a touch of rustic charm to their bedrooms. These headboards are made from salvaged wood, often sourced from old barns or buildings, and feature a unique patina that cannot be replicated. The natural variations in color and texture make each piece truly one-of-a-kind, adding a sense of history and character to your spac

In addition to aesthetics, functionality is a key consideration when choosing a headboard. Many modern wooden headboards come with added features such as built-in storage or integrated lighting solutions. These designs cater to homeowners looking to maximize space in smaller bedrooms while still maintaining a stylish look. For example, a headboard with shelves can provide an excellent space for books, decorative items, or even bedside essentials, all within easy reach.
